As a Staten Island Women's Bar Association member, you have access to a statewide network of women active in all facets of life in the State of New York. SIWBA is a Women's Bar Association of the State of New York (WBASNY) chapter. WBASNY members serve on committees that impact the policy and planning process for all statewide legislation and policymaking, whether civil, criminal, or commercial. 


As a chapter member, consider serving on a chapter committee while co-chairing a similar statewide committee. The service would allow you to be the pipeline for your committee to the rest of the chapter, bringing issues forward and taking feedback to the stewed committee. It is exhilarating when you see your words appear in a Memorandum accompanying a bill before the Legislature or in an amicus brief submitted by WBASNY regarding precedent-setting litigation.
